How to become a makeup artist

How to become a makeup artist

Being a makeup artist offers the potential for many exciting career opportunities – from working with celebrities and stylists, to running your own business. Whether you’ve dreamed of being a makeup artist your whole life or want to make a career change, here are some tips on how you can become the next Bobbi Brown.

Practice! - Practice makes perfect and this is definitely the case with makeup artistry. Whether it’s experimenting with different looks or practicing on friends, the more you do it, the better you’ll become. Hands-on experience working at a makeup counter is a great way to build your skillset, too.

Research the best makeup artists - With any trade, you need to learn it inside out. The best way to do this is to research the famous makeup artists including the likes of Charlotte Tilbury and Pat McGrath, figure out what you like about their work, and implement some of those elements into your own style.

Qualify – To learn makeup artistry professionally, you should enroll in college or night school. If you research the schools nearby, you’ll be able to see what’s on offer, the cost, and the length of the courses. School will not only aid your knowledge and experience, but it can also help you apply for and land makeup artist jobs as well.

Market yourself - The beauty of social media is that anyone can become famous and start a business. You can set up profiles showcasing your makeup skills, share them with your friends and followers, and potentially grow your business from there.

So, if you can’t stop obsessing about beauty trends and love experimenting with the latest makeup looks, then makeup artistry may just be the career for you.
